Tests will now be built at `meson test`-time, so there's no cost if the
user isn't going to run them.
This is better than guarding on build type, as distros may want to test production
builds before shipping.

Adding meson build files for json-c that work similarly to the cmake build files.
Where it made sense, I reused existing cmake .h.in files or generated entirely from meson.
All tests were done with GCC and Clang in ubuntu 24.04, Windows using MSVC 2022 and Clang-cl from llvm's repo using version 21.1.3
